About The Benson Portland, Curio Collection by Hilton
Located in Portland city center, this historic Oregon hotel is 12 miles from Portland International Airport. Offering on-site dining and a 24-hour gym, this hotel features elegant rooms with free WiFi. Featuring a flat-screen TV with cable, all rooms at Benson Hotel include tea and coffee-making facilities, free toiletries,a bathrobe,and slippers are provided in a sealed format only and upon request. Serving breakfast, lunch and dinner, The Palm Court lobby restaurant offers wine and spirits. Showcasing Italian marble floors and Austrian crystal chandeliers, The Benson Portland offers conference center, a business center complete with fax and photocopy services. The 100% smoke-free hotel has laundry facilities. Complimentary morning Starbucks® coffee and tea service is offered in the lobby. Located 2 minutes' walk from SW 6th & Pine Street MAX Light Rail Station, this hotel offers easy access to a variety of local attractions including the trendy Pearl District, 10 minutes’ walk away. Powell's Books is 4 minutes’ walk away.

The Benson Hotel is a historic and beautiful property with a convenient location in downtown Portland. Guests generally praise the hotel's staff, cleanliness, and comfort, but some express concerns about the surrounding area's homeless population and safety. Recent changes under Hilton management have received mixed reviews, with some guests feeling that the hotel's charm and service have declined.
